This is Jason and Dan, they are agemates, they are both 6 years old and have become like brothers -best friends. They both lost their parents to HIV/Aids.

They joined the Orphanage at 3 yrs. They were brought to the orphanage at the same time by Sarah one of our team who helps identify orphans in great need.. Dan and Jason are loved and cared for at the Orphanage. They have a real home, with a safe place to sleep, food and fun school with many friends to play soccer with.

They both love soccer and praying to Jesus!

Their smiles are a great reminder that Jesus lives in their hearts and that they have Joy and real hope for the future.


George is 11 years old and one of the older kids at the orphanage. George lost both his mom and dad to HIV/AIDS at 4 years old.

He went to live with his Auntie who beat him a lot, refused to send him to school and overworked him. One day at the age of 5 George ran away from his Aunties home and ended up a street kid in Mbale town.

He was picked up by a church member who brought him to Impact Orphanage. George felt welcomed immediately at the orphanage. The fear went away and he felt loved, knowing that he had found a real home where the love of Jesus gave him peace.

George loves to teach other kids God’s word and says he wants to be a street preacher and share the Good News of our Lord Jesus Christ to everyone!
